Many providers receive payments from medical companies such as pharmaceutical companies and medical device companies. These payments can range from small amounts for meals to large consulting fees. We provide this information in order to make healthcare system more transparent. Between 2014 and 2020 Elizabeth Loverso, PA-C has received over $333 which includes payments from the following companies:
  • $232.31 from AstraZeneca Pharmaceuticals LP
  • $64.93 from Pfizer Inc.
  • $18.47 from Amgen Inc.
  • $17.88 from Novartis Pharmaceuticals Corporation
Payments received by Elizabeth Loverso, PA-C were from the following categories:
  • $333.59 Food and Beverage

Diabetes Foot Care — Why People with Diabetes Need to See a Podiatrist Regularly
Everyone who has diabetes should have an annual foot check to prevent any serious problems resulting from having type I or type II diabetes. Diabetes is a systemic disease that affects different parts of the body, and as such, it may require different practitioners to treat or manage.
